GEORGANNE DEEN


Georganne Deen is a polymathic artist whose output takes many forms, including painting, digital drawing, poetry, and music. Southern gothic and new age cross paths often in Deen's work, and Flannery O'Connor's prose is just as likely to appear in a piece as imagery from a glamour advertisement. She has mastered her own distinct, captivating form of experimental narrative, which permeates everything she does, regardless of medium. The piece below is our favorite of Deen's earlier paintings.

Georganne Deen currently lives in Joshua Tree, CA. She studied with Lee Baxter Davis at East Texas State Unviersity and has has had numerous solo exhibitions worldwide. She is also a poet and musician. She also has work in Issue Four's Early Edition.
